Abstract: A process is provided for making a free-flowing powder of a complex of an alpha-hydroxy acid (AHA) and/or a beta-hydroxy acid (BHA) and a vinylpyrrolidone (PVP) polymer, copolymer or graft polymers, as the complexing agent, at high acid loadings, preferably 20-60% by weight. The presence of VP polymers, copolymers or graft polymers in the complex reduces the skin irritation effect of the acid when applied to the skin of the user. The process involves applying an aqueous solution or slurry of the acid to PVP, and, substantially immediately thereafter, evaporating the water to form a free-flowing powder of the complex of the acid and VP polymers, copolymers or graft polymers.

Abstract: Compositions containing sulfuric acid and one or more of certain chalcogen-containing compounds in which the chalcogen compound/H.sub.2 SO.sub.4 molar ratio is below 2 contain the mono-adduct of sulfuric acid which is catalytically active for promoting organic chemical reactions. Suitable chalcogen-containing compounds have the empirical formula ##STR1## wherein X is a chalcogen, each of R.sub.1 and R.sub.2 is independently selected from hydrogen, NR.sub.3 R.sub.4, and NR.sub.5, at least one of R.sub.1 and R.sub.2 is other than hydrogen, each of R.sub.3 and R.sub.4 is hydrogen or a monovalent organic radical, and R.sub.5 is a divalent organic radical. Such compositions are useful for catalyzing organic reactions such as oxidation, oxidative addition, reduction, reductive addition, esterification, transesterification, hydrogenation, isomerication (including racemization of optical isomers), alkylation, polymerization, demetallization of organometallics, nitration, Friedel-Crafts reactions, and hydrolysis.
